Gregg Berger
Gregg is known to Transformers fans the world over as the voice of Grimlock,
everyone's favourite Dinobot! As well as that, Gregg voiced numerous other
characters during G1 including Skyfire, Outback, Longhaul and several others.
Away from Transforers he has worked on a host of other animated shows including
GI Joe, Spiderman and has provided the voice for Odie in all of the Garfield
cartoons including the recent CGI movies alongside fellow Transformers actors
Frank Welker, Neil Ross and Wally Wingert! He has also had an extensive career

Ian James Corlett
Ian provided the voice of Cheetor in Beast Wars and it's
follow-up series Beast Machines for five seasons from 1996 and was one of the
shows most popular characters. Away from Transformers, Ian has had a diverse

Andrew Wildman

Joining us for an astonishing sixth time, Andrew is an
established comic illustrator and worked on the original G1 series for Marvel
with Simon Furman and has worked steadily on Transformers comics ever since
working with almost every publisher who has had the rights to produce
Transformers comics from Marvel, Dreamwave, IDW Publishing, Panini and now
Titan Magazines! He is co-owner of
Wildfur with Simon

Simon Williams
Making his fifth and very welcome appearance at Auto
Assembly is comic artist Simon Williams. Simon has worked on the UK
Transformers: Armada comic for Panini, has done Transformers
illustrations for SFX magazine and has also worked IDW
Publishing. In addition, Simon created the covers for the Season 3/4 and
Season 1 G1 box sets for Metrodome and since 2005 he has been doing
artwork for Auto Assembly providing cover artwork for The Cybertronian Times
and artwork for our exclusive postcards.

Lee Sullivan
Making his long awaited return to Auto Assembly is Lee
Sullivan. Lee has been responsible for a vast amount of work on the Marvel UK
G1 comic as well as working on Doctor Who and William Shatner's Tek War series.
Since 2004 Lee has also been one of the regular postcard / Cybertronian Times
cover artists for Auto Assembly!

Jon Davis-Hunt

Making his Transformers convention debut is Jon-Davis Hunt. Jon has recently
joined the team working on Titan Magazine's Transformers comic as their new
regular artist for their UK-originated strip, although he has produced cover
artwork for them previously. He has also worked for IDW on the adaptation of
Revenge Of The Fallen and was one of the artists for 2000 AD. Prior to
switching to the comic industry, Jon previously worked in the video games
